i just got a set of road attacks 500 mile ago they feel great ,iv not got much exp on them but so far so good,very good in the wet (feel very secure ) and in the dry theyre ace(i bet you dont run out of tread)u can get it right over .but i find they 'tip in'very quick, good for the twisties just dont turn in too early.i know u didnt ask but thats my opinion of them

Quote:
Originally Posted by jim@55
but i find they 'tip in'very quick,
This is a good point. The first thing that I noticed with the conti's, apart from the cool looking tread pattern, was the profile of the tyre. Quite a bit oval compared to the Bridgestone 0 series. And yes I also noticed it liked to tip over quickly, but still it felt controlled.
